The Regina Police Service is asking the public’s help in locating a female teenager who has been reported missing. Police do not have any indication that 14 year-old Nevaeh WALKER has come to harm, but there are concerns for her safety and vulnerability, given her age.
Fourteen year-old Nevaeh WALKER was last seen on January 14, 2023, at about 11:00 p.m. on Marshall Crescent in the Normanview neighbourhood. Nevaeh WALKER is described as Female, Indigenous, 5’ 1” tall, weighing about 120 pounds, thin build. She has straight, red, shoulder-length hair and brown eyes. When last seen she was wearing a black winter jacket (or hoodie), ripped blue jeans, and high-top, black/red/white Nike runners.
Anyone who has information that would help police locate Nevaeh WALKER is asked to contact the Regina Police Service at 306-777-6500 or Regina Crime Stoppers at https://www.reginacrimestoppers.ca/ or 1-800-222-TIPS (8477).
